which doctor to consult for urinary infection - #28048

Reyansh

I am really confused about which doctor to consult for urinary infection. Like, I thought I could just go to my general physician, but they seem to send me to a urologist every time I mention my symptoms? I’ve been having these weird urinary infections for the last few months! At first, it was just mild, some burning sensation and frequent urination, but now it feels more serious, and I don’t know who to talk to. The last time I visited my GP, he’d prescribed antibiotics, but they didn’t do much and I ended up with another infection just weeks later. Then, I thought maybe a urologist would have a better handle on the situation! But honestly, is that really the right step? Or should I be looking at a different type of specialist? It’s so frustrating because every time I think I’m on the right track, things just go sideways. If anyone has gone through a similar thing or knows which doctor to consult for urinary infection, I’d really appreciate any advice on this. I just want to feel better and stop the cycle of infections!

From your description, it sounds like you’re dealing with recurrent urinary tract infections (UTIs), which can indeed be frustrating and persistently uncomfortable. Generally speaking, a general practitioner (GP) is a good starting point for diagnosing and treating simple urinary infections. They are well-equipped to prescribe antibiotics and give initial advice on management. However, since you have been experiencing frequent and possibly more complex symptoms despite treatment, seeing a urologist is a very reasonable next step. Urologists specialize in the urinary tract system and can offer a more detailed evaluation. They might perform additional tests to understand what’s causing the recurrent infections, such as imaging studies or a cystoscopy, which allows them to look inside the bladder. It’s important to pinpoint any underlying issues that might predispose you to recurrent infections, like an anatomical abnormality or incomplete bladder emptying.

Aside from urologists, consider seeing a specialist in infectious diseases if urinary infections persist despite clear urology findings. They can delve into a broader spectrum of causes, including resistant bacteria or other complicating factors. Remember to keep your urologist informed of your previous treatments and symptoms to provide them with a comprehensive history. Meanwhile, ensure you’re practicing good hygiene, staying well-hydrated, and possibly modifying any lifestyle factors that might contribute to repeated infections.

If symptoms like severe pain, blood in urine, or fever arise, immediate attention is warranted, as these could be signs of a more severe infection needing urgent intervention. Your healthcare provider will be the best guide on whether further tests, antibiotic adjustments, or preventive strategies are needed. It’s understandable to feel frustrated, but with the right specialist’s input, managing recurrent UTIs becomes more streamlined and effective.
